Whats does pemdas mean
Bumek [7]
Its a common technique for remembering the order of operations. The abbreviation pemdas is turned into the phrase "Please excuse my Dear Aunt Sally". It stands for "Parentheses, Exponents, Multiplication and Division, and Addition and Subtraction.

Step-by-step explanation:

Information given

\bar X=7.43 represent the sampke mean in minutes

s=3.6 represent the sample standard deviation

n=64 sample size  

\mu_o =8 represent the value to verify

\alpha=0.005 represent the significance level

t would represent the statistic (variable of interest)  

p_v represent the p value

System of hypothesis

For this case we are trying to proof if inspection station advertises that the wait time for customers is less than 8 minutes, the system of hypothesis would be:  

Null hypothesis:\mu \geq 8  

Alternative hypothesis:\mu < 8  

Since the population deviation is not known the statistic can be calculated with:

t=\frac{\bar X-\mu_o}{\frac{s}{\sqrt{n}}}  (1)  

The statistic for this case is given by:

t=\frac{7.43-8}{\frac{3.6}{\sqrt{64}}}=-1.27    

The degrees of freedom are given by:

df=n-1=64-1=63  

The p value can be calculated like this:

p_v =P(t_{(63)}  

For this case since the p value is higher than the significance level we have enough evidence to conclude that the true mean for the wait time is not significantly less than 8 minutes
